Day 4: Samburu National Park
Samburu National Reserve, often simply referred to as Samburu, is a protected wildlife conservation area located in the northern part of Kenya, in the Samburu County. It is part of a larger ecosystem that also includes the neighboring Buffalo Springs National Reserve and Shaba National Reserve. Samburu is renowned for its unique and diverse wildlife, dramatic landscapes, and its appeal to both tourists and researchers interested in African wildlife and culture.

Day 5: Samburu - Lake Nakuru
This national park, known for its bird life, offers the opportunity to observe flamingos. It is also home to black and white rhinos, as well as the endangered Rothschild giraffe.

Day 7: Masai Mara
The Masai Mara is home to vast rolling hills, forests, river jungles and millions of animals. Its famous Mara River is the site of the annual spectacle of the wildebeest migration. The reserve is also a bird paradise with more than 450 different species!

Stone Town Tour (Half Day)

Stone Town is one of the few intact historic Swahili trading towns in East Africa. In 2000 it was declared a UNESCO World Heritage Site.
The excursion takes you to the legendary Stone Town, where history seems to have stood still. The fascinating architectural design of the town's stone buildings, with their carved and studded wooden doors shaded by balconies and verandas that line the narrow, winding streets, testifies to a rich cultural heritage that blends Arab, Persian, Indian and European traditions with African traditions.
The excursion includes a visit to the bustling city market, the former slave market, the House of Miracles, the Sultan's Palace, the Arab fortress and more. You will also have time for shopping. Stone Town has a variety of excellent souvenir and craft shops.
